There were recent updates to @update.afni.binaries, afni_system_check.py and apsearch to deal with zsh, including for AFNI command option completion (apsearch) and setting up .zshrc (in @update.afni.binaries).

The zsh format for option completion is more restricted than the bash format, so we had to create new files for zsh.

The 10.12_local package is still compiled against R 3.6. That is not an AFNI restriction, it is a macos_10.12_local package restriction (which is currently the only mac package we build). We plan to build against 4.0 as well, in a new package, but have not gotten to it yet. Sorry.
